Section 73-18-35 - Term of office for director. (Effective July 1, 2022.)

Universal Citation: NM Stat § 73-18-35 (2020)

The regular term of office for a director is four years, and the director shall serve until a successor has been chosen and has qualified. A director shall qualify by taking an oath of office. Newly elected directors shall take office on the date that their terms of office begin following the election of the director.

History: 1953 Comp., § 75-32-35, enacted by Laws 1955, ch. 281, § 11; 2018, ch. 79, § 157.

ANNOTATIONS

The 2018 amendment, effective July 1, 2022, revised the language related to the beginning dates of the term of office of director; and after "four years, and", added "the director shall serve", and after "shall take office", deleted "at the next regular meeting of the board of directors" and added "on the date that their terms of office begin".

Temporary provisions. — Laws 2018, ch. 79, § 173 provided:

A. The term of a conservancy district or watershed district board member that was set to expire on or before June 30, 2024 pursuant to the governing statutes of that district in effect before July 1, 2022 shall expire on December 31, 2023, and that member's successor shall be elected in the local election held on the first Tuesday after the first Monday of November 2023 for a term beginning on January 1, 2024.

B. The term of a conservancy district or watershed district board member that was set to expire on or after July 1, 2024 but on or before June 30, 2026 pursuant to the governing statutes of that district in effect before July 1, 2022 shall expire on December 31, 2025, and that member's successor shall be elected in the local election held on the first Tuesday after the first Monday of November 2025 for a term beginning on January 1, 2026.

C. The term of a conservancy district or watershed district board member that was set to expire on or after July 1, 2026 pursuant to the governing statutes of that district in effect before July 1, 2022 shall expire on December 31, 2027, and that member's successor shall be elected in the local election held on the first Tuesday after the first Monday of November 2027 for a term beginning on January 1, 2028.
